Mini Giant Clone (Schumacher Mini Monster)

Wife and kids went shopping for me. I was shocked to come home today and see some gifts under the tree for me today. I told the kids they could open if they want. If you know kids, they did not hesitate - they ripped open all three boxes and gift wrap went everywhere fast....

I did not get one but TWO of the Schumacher Mini Monsters and one set of bearings. Wife and kids went to ModelsportUK and got a blue and a red one.
http://www.racing-cars.com/usa/produ...ecnumber=65353

They only had one set of bearings in stock so I have to wait and get the other set later. But that is ok for now. I am just excited that I got the little trucks. I have been talking about them for a while so wife went and got them for me.

After taking most of it apart and comparing to hop-ups available for Mini Giant. These seem to be exact same truck. Anyone else have these?

So far I love it. I am using my battery packs from my MiniT.
